Notable Talents on the Rise

One standout in this class is five-star prospect Carter Reynolds from Texas, who at 6'6'' and 290 pounds, demonstrates remarkable agility for his size. Reynolds has a natural ability to move laterally, making him a formidable presence on the field. Scouts are already noting his impressive footwork and hand placement during pass protection drills, hinting at a future where he could potentially anchor an NFL offensive line. His performance at recent camps has solidified his status as a top-tier recruit, with several programs vying for his commitment.

Another name to watch is Malik Johnson from Florida, who has impressed coaches with both his strength and fundamentals. Weighing in at 300 pounds, Johnson possesses an explosive first step and has shown the ability to dominate defensive linemen with his physical play. His coaches praise his work ethic and his keen understanding of offensive schemes, making him not only a physical asset but also a cerebral player. As he continues to develop, there’s little doubt that Johnson could become a household name in college football—and beyond.
